Storing a removed drive shaft is best handled with a sock. Place the sock over the U-joint and it will hold the caps in place and prevent the grease from getting smeared anywhere.
Used serpentine and V-belts make great strap wrenches. Combined with pliers or vice grips, you can get a hold on just about anything round.
Caught in a jam with only a standard wrench to try and turn a metric bolt or nut? Spare change from your pocket, like a penny or dime, can be used to slide between the wrench and bolt, taking up the slack and allowing you to turn the fastener.

Tapping holes is no cause for concern until you break a tap in the hole. To prevent binding the tap and risking breakage, turn the tap a 1/2-turn forward and a 1/4-turn backwards, then repeat until completed. You will never break a tap again, as the 1/4-turn rearward clears the tap debris.
